About #A8BDD3

When working with digital screens, the color #A8BDD3 is rendered by mixing light. It is closely associated with the named CSS color Lightsteelblue. To achieve this exact tint on a monitor, you would use an RGB mix of 168, 189, and 211.

For print applications, it's crucial to understand its CMYK makeup. To reproduce this shade on paper, a printer utilizes 20% cyan and 10% magenta inks. Always request a physical proof before doing a large print run with this exact code.

Contrast ratios determine whether this color is safe for typography. To prevent eye strain, #000000 text pairs best with this hex code. Always test your color combinations using a contrast checker before publishing.

Color Space Conversions

HEX#A8BDD3
RGB168, 189, 211
HSL210.7°, 32.8%, 74.3%
CMYK20%, 10%, 0%, 17%
HSV210.7°, 20.4%, 82.7%
LAB75.7, -2.5, -13.4
XYZ46.1, 49.4, 68.7
Decimal11058643
